Acai Berry - More to it than Easy Weight Loss

By

Americans have always loved to lose weight, and lately, we love to be healthy as well. The thing is, we often take our health and diet tips from the media and celebrities, and sometimes, we don't get the whole story. Fortunately, the acai (ah-sigh-ee) berry craze is somewhat less complicated than things like low-carb and all-liquid diets. And while a lot of the hype is no more than . . . well, hype, the acai berry itself is a wonderful little fruit. The acai berry grows in the rainforests of Brazil, where for centuries the natives have enjoyed its health benefits. Resembling a blueberry or small grape, it is said to taste like berries and chocolate. The edible flesh makes up only about 10% of the berry, while the pit is the other 90%. Once picked, the acai berry generally spoils within a day. Because of that, the acai berry - in its purest form - is difficult to get. Some companies are managing to harvest, package, and ship quality acai products to consumers willing to spend the money. But numerous others are jumping on the bandwagon, offering products that are mostly filler with little actual acai. Buyer beware.

Still, celebrities like Oprah and Rachel Ray have publicized the weight loss benefits of acai berry, and America is responding with its own success stories. The berry does contain elements that boost metabolism and suppress appetite, but experts feel the weight loss claims have been exaggerated. As a health trend, the acai berry is a contemporary of the pomegranate and blueberry. All are rich in antioxidant properties, though acai scores higher than both. Just to give an idea, using the USDA's Oxygen Radical Absorbance Capacity (ORAC) scale, blueberries scored 32, while acai berry scored 167. Just for fun, we're including some celebrity diet tips that might go well with an acai berry regimen. Interestingly, most of them are about what you should eat, rather than what you shouldn't.

Eat Breakfast: Eating within the first half-hour after waking jump starts your metabolism and gets you going. Whole wheat toast, scrambled egg whites, fruit, and oatmeal provide beneficial protein and fiber.

Choose the Healthy Carbs: White pasta, bread, and rice, as well as sweets like cake and cookies have lots of sugar and very little nutrition. Eating them causes your body to use that quick burst of energy rather than your fat stores. Get your carbs through whole wheat products, fruits, and vegetables.

Be Veggie Particular: Trade gas-producing vegetables like broccoli and cauliflower for watery ones such as lettuce, celery, and cucumbers. Also, green beans and asparagus are high in fiber, but won't expand your stomach.

Add Some Spice: Cayenne pepper, jalapenos, and other spices boost the metabolism, and also add to your satisfaction while eating, which can discourage overeating. Herbs and spices are a great way of adding flavor without fat or salt.

Snack Between Meals: Noshing on healthy tidbits during the day can help you resist overeating at meals. Keep portable snacks like berries, crackers, or low-fat sting cheese on hand when you're on the go.
